Wagtailtrans 项目教程
1. 项目的目录结构及介绍
Wagtailtrans 项目的目录结构如下:
wagtailtrans/
├── docs/
│ └── ...
├── src/
│ └── wagtailtrans/
│ ├── migrations/
│ ├── models/
│ ├── settings/
│ ├── templates/
│ └── ...
├── tests/
│ └── ...
├── .codecov.yml
├── .coveragerc
├── .editorconfig
├── .gitignore
├── CHANGELOG.rst
├── CONTRIBUTING.md
├── CONTRIBUTORS.rst
├── LICENSE
├── MANIFEST.in
├── Makefile
├── README.rst
├── manage.py
├── setup.cfg
├── setup.py
└── tox.ini
目录结构介绍
- docs/: 包含项目的文档文件。
- src/wagtailtrans/: 包含 Wagtailtrans 的核心代码,包括模型、设置、模板等。
- migrations/: 包含数据库迁移文件。
- models/: 包含 Django 模型定义。
- settings/: 包含项目的配置文件。
- templates/: 包含项目的模板文件。
- tests/: 包含项目的测试代码。
- .codecov.yml: Codecov 配置文件。
- .coveragerc: 代码覆盖率配置文件。
- .editorconfig: 编辑器配置文件。
- .gitignore: Git 忽略文件配置。
- CHANGELOG.rst: 项目变更日志。
- CONTRIBUTING.md: 贡献指南。
- CONTRIBUTORS.rst: 贡献者列表。
- LICENSE: 项目许可证。
- MANIFEST.in: 打包清单文件。
- Makefile: 项目构建文件。
- README.rst: 项目介绍和使用说明。
- manage.py: Django 管理脚本。
- setup.cfg: 项目配置文件。
- setup.py: 项目安装脚本。
- tox.ini: Tox 配置文件。
2. 项目的启动文件介绍
manage.py
manage.py
是 Django 项目的管理脚本,用于执行各种管理任务,如启动开发服务器、创建数据库迁移、运行测试等。
python manage.py runserver
setup.py
setup.py
是用于安装和分发 Python 包的脚本。通过该文件,可以安装 Wagtailtrans 包。
pip install .
3. 项目的配置文件介绍
setup.cfg
setup.cfg
是项目的配置文件,包含了一些元数据和配置选项,用于打包和分发项目。
.coveragerc
.coveragerc
是代码覆盖率配置文件,用于配置代码覆盖率工具的行为。
.editorconfig
.editorconfig
是编辑器配置文件,用于统一不同编辑器和 IDE 的代码风格。
.gitignore
.gitignore
是 Git 忽略文件配置,用于指定哪些文件和目录不需要被 Git 跟踪。
Makefile
Makefile
是项目构建文件,包含了一些常用的构建命令,如运行测试、生成文档等。
make test
tox.ini
tox.ini
是 Tox 配置文件,用于自动化测试和环境管理。
tox
通过以上介绍,您可以更好地理解和使用 Wagtailtrans 项目。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考